Understanding Smoke: What Is It?
Smoke is a complex mixture of gases, vapors, and fine particulate matter produced when organic material burns. It contains numerous harmful chemicals that can pose health risks and cause extensive damage to property.
How Smoke Differs from Fire
- Composition: Smoke consists of carbon monoxide, carbon dioxide, volatile organic compounds (VOCs), and other toxic substances.
- Behavior: Smoke travels quickly through buildings, rising to ceilings and spreading into walls and furniture.
Types of Smoke Damage
Wet Smoke: Produced by burning synthetic materials; it has a pungent odor and sticks to surfaces. Dry Smoke: Creates less residue but is often more difficult to remove. Fuel Oil Soot: Comes from burning fuel oil; typically found in basements or near heating sources. The Importance of Quick Response by Fire Restoration Companies

The Cleaning Process: Steps Involved in Smoke Removal
When you contact a fire restoration contractor after a fire incident, expect a systematic approach:
1. Assessment of Damage
- Inspect all areas affected by smoke.
- Identify types of smoke damage present.
2. Containment
- Prevent the spread of smoke odor using barriers like plastic sheeting.
3. Air Filtration
- Use air scrubbers equipped with HEPA filters to remove airborne particles.
4. Cleaning Techniques
- Employ specialized equipment like thermal foggers for deep penetration cleaning.
- Use ozone generators cautiously, as they can be harmful if not handled properly.
5. Deodorization Methods
- Chemical agents may be applied for odor neutralization after thorough cleaning.

The Role of pH Levels
Different cleaning agents have various pH levels that react differently with soot:
| Cleaning Agent | pH Level | Type of Smoke Effective Against | |-------------------------|----------|--------------------------------| | Alkaline Cleaners | High | Dry Smoke | | Acidic Cleaners | Low | Wet Smoke |
This table illustrates how using inappropriate cleaning agents may worsen stains or odors rather than alleviate them.
